From fd9f85d65951c862bae466d2b32b30ecc171c7a7 Mon Sep 17 00:00:00 2001 From: Arlen Johnson Date: Fri, 28 Feb 2025 13:02:26 -0500 Subject: [PATCH 1/3] Improve EnvSource petition display and make Attribute Collector displays consistent (CFM-116) --- .../cell/AttributeCollectors/display.php | 5 +- .../cell/BasicAttributeCollectors/display.php | 2 +- .../cell/EnvSourceCollectors/display.php | 46 ++++++++++++++++--- app/webroot/css/co-base.css | 31 +++++++++++-- app/webroot/css/co-responsive.css | 16 ++++--- 5 files changed, 78 insertions(+), 22 deletions(-) diff --git a/app/plugins/CoreEnroller/templates/cell/AttributeCollectors/display.php b/app/plugins/CoreEnroller/templates/cell/AttributeCollectors/display.php index b59a82a41..b87c2618e 100644 --- a/app/plugins/CoreEnroller/templates/cell/AttributeCollectors/display.php +++ b/app/plugins/CoreEnroller/templates/cell/AttributeCollectors/display.php @@ -63,10 +63,9 @@ ['controller' => \App\Lib\Util\StringUtilities::foreignKeyToController($attribute->attribute), 'action' => 'edit', $attr->value]); } ?> -
  • +
  • label ?>

    -
    -
    +
  • diff --git a/app/plugins/CoreEnroller/templates/cell/BasicAttributeCollectors/display.php b/app/plugins/CoreEnroller/templates/cell/BasicAttributeCollectors/display.php index 88b9562f0..c43d1474a 100644 --- a/app/plugins/CoreEnroller/templates/cell/BasicAttributeCollectors/display.php +++ b/app/plugins/CoreEnroller/templates/cell/BasicAttributeCollectors/display.php @@ -58,7 +58,7 @@
  • -
  • +
  • Email Address

  • diff --git a/app/plugins/EnvSource/templates/cell/EnvSourceCollectors/display.php b/app/plugins/EnvSource/templates/cell/EnvSourceCollectors/display.php index ffe95799e..93adc1276 100644 --- a/app/plugins/EnvSource/templates/cell/EnvSourceCollectors/display.php +++ b/app/plugins/EnvSource/templates/cell/EnvSourceCollectors/display.php @@ -34,14 +34,46 @@ return; } -$env_attributes = json_decode($vv_petition_env_identities->env_source_identity->env_attributes); - +$env_attributes = json_decode($vv_petition_env_identities->env_source_identity->env_attributes, true); +ksort($env_attributes); +$previousKey = ''; ?> -